A growing coalition of people in the crypto community is buzzing over new mining equipment purchases, blending excitement with concerns about rising operational costs. Recent discussions on various forums underscore both the eagerness to capitalize on current market trends and the looming threat of hefty electricity bills.
Several enthusiasts are chiming in about their recent mining rig acquisitions. One noted, "My 2 S9 will come tomorrow. Can't wait to install them!" The enthusiasm is evident, signaling increased investments in mining gear as crypto prices climb.
While the hype is growing, so too are concerns about costs. Comments like, "Enjoy your $500 electric bill π" reflect a shared apprehension among miners about spiraling expenses. Additionally, a comment shared on forums suggests "You should check out Powerpool. You are losing 3% of your hashrate to ViaBTC crazy high fees." This highlights ongoing discussions about optimizing mining efficiency and reducing costs.
People continue to seek advice on maximizing their mining operations. One asked, "How much does it heat up Avalon nano 3s?" indicating a trend of members wanting to manage heat outputs effectively. The community is also evaluating various miners, with one stating, "I was just about to get a nerd solo miner, was looking at different ones last night." This exchange reflects the collaborative effort among miners to enhance their setups.
